The experience of pregnancy and childbirth results in significant changes to the body, and it is entirely normal to retain weight and have an altered abdominal appearance afterward. Postpartum belly fat is a combination of remaining gestational fat storage, fluid retention, and the physical stretching of the abdominal wall. The desire to regain strength and modify body composition is common, but the focus must remain on safe, gradual, and health-first strategies. A sustainable approach emphasizes healing the body from the inside out, prioritizing recovery over rapid changes.
Understanding Postpartum Body Changes
The persistence of the abdominal profile after birth is due to several intersecting physiological factors. During pregnancy, the connective tissue that runs down the center of the abdomen, the linea alba, stretches to accommodate the growing uterus. This stretching often leads to diastasis recti, a separation of the left and right abdominal muscles, which causes the belly to protrude even when body fat levels are low.
Hormonal shifts influence fat distribution. High levels of estrogen and progesterone during pregnancy promote fat storage, particularly around the midsection, as energy reserves for breastfeeding. After delivery, these hormone levels drop rapidly, aiding weight loss, but the process is not instant. The hormone relaxin, which loosens ligaments for childbirth, can remain elevated for months, affecting core stability and delaying connective tissue repair. The body also holds onto extra fluid and blood volume for a period following birth, contributing to temporary swelling and weight.
Safe Timelines and Medical Clearance
Any weight loss or exercise regimen must follow a period of dedicated physical recovery. The uterus undergoes involution, shrinking back to its pre-pregnancy size, a process that takes several weeks. Most healthcare providers recommend waiting for the standard six-week postpartum check-up before initiating structured exercise.
Medical clearance is especially important for those who have undergone a C-section, which is major abdominal surgery. C-section recovery can extend to 12 weeks or more before high-impact activity is cleared. Even with a vaginal delivery, this check-up ensures the healing of the pelvic floor and any tears or incisions is progressing appropriately. Focusing on gentle movement, such as short walks, is appropriate before this official clearance, provided it does not increase pain or bleeding.
Nutritional Strategies for Sustainable Loss
Dietary adjustments should focus on nutrient density to support recovery and energy, rather than severe caloric restriction. Prioritizing whole foods, including fruits, vegetables, lean proteins, and healthy fats, helps provide the micronutrients necessary for tissue repair. Adequate protein intake is particularly important for maintaining muscle mass and supporting the body’s healing processes.
For mothers who are breastfeeding, a conservative approach to caloric reduction is necessary to protect milk supply. Breastfeeding naturally burns an average of 250 to 500 extra calories per day, contributing to gradual weight loss without conscious dieting. A safe minimum caloric intake for most nursing mothers is between 1,500 and 1,800 calories per day, and many require the higher end of that range.
Weight loss should be gradual, typically no more than 1.5 pounds per week, to avoid negatively impacting milk production or releasing stored environmental toxins into the breast milk. Hydration is also a major factor, as water supports metabolism and is necessary for milk production. Avoiding quick-fix diets and highly processed foods helps stabilize blood sugar and prevents sudden drops in energy that can hinder recovery.
Targeted Movement and Core Recovery
After medical clearance, movement should initially focus on rebuilding the core from the inside out, particularly if abdominal separation is present. Diastasis recti involves the widening of the linea alba, and attempting exercises that create excessive intra-abdominal pressure can worsen the condition. Therefore, traditional exercises like crunches, sit-ups, and full planks should generally be avoided in the early stages of core recovery.
Safe starting exercises focus on engaging the transverse abdominis, the deepest layer of the core muscles. Examples include pelvic tilts and the “connection breath,” which involves gently drawing the belly button toward the spine on the exhale. Any movement that causes the abdomen to bulge or “cone” along the midline should be modified or stopped immediately.
Once core stability is re-established, the routine can gradually incorporate low-impact cardio, such as brisk walking or cycling, and strength training. Resistance work is beneficial because increasing muscle mass helps boost metabolism over time. Progression should be slow, moving from bodyweight exercises to light resistance, ensuring that the core can manage the load without symptoms.
Lifestyle Factors Supporting Fat Loss
Beyond diet and exercise, non-physical factors play a significant role in how the body stores fat, especially around the midsection. Chronic stress and the resulting elevation of the hormone cortisol are closely linked to increased abdominal fat deposition. Cortisol, the body’s main stress hormone, when consistently high, can stimulate fat storage and even interfere with blood sugar regulation.
Prioritizing sleep, even if fragmented, helps to regulate these stress hormones. Lack of sleep is a common cause of chronic stress in new parents and contributes to elevated cortisol levels. Sleep deprivation can also alter the balance of appetite-regulating hormones, increasing ghrelin (the hunger hormone) and decreasing leptin (the satiety hormone).
